"Recession Ate It" is the creation of travel company Adventurous Wench. Founder Deanna Keahey said "I've heard from so many people who can't take the vacation they wanted this year. Some had to cancel due to a job loss. Others took a pay cut, are working decreased hours, or see their own business spiraling downward. It's a beastly situation, that's affecting almost all of us."

$1 from every shirt purchased will go to The Children's Health Fund, a charity which helps children who need health care. As millions of parents have lost jobs and their ability to pay for health care, more and more children are left at risk. Keahey says "Many of us have had to cut back in this recession, including giving up that vacation. But some people are hurting a lot more than others, including innocent children. I want to help however we can. We're all in this together."

About Adventurous Wench

Adventurous Wench specializes in high-quality soft adventure trips for women. Guests enjoy outdoor activities such as hiking or sailing, with excellent cuisine, fine accommodations, and knowledgeable guides.
